The point is that if it's the instrument's problem - if the E11 itself is causing the pitch variances - practicing won't solve it. Taking it to a skilled repair tech might, but it will not be inexpensive. You can correct small pitch discrepancies with embouchure or internal oral adjustments, but 20 cents flat or sharp is a lot to compensate for, and if you have to do it for too many notes it isn't reasonable. Your ideal goal is to keep as stable an embouchure as possible, and adjusting to widely varying pitch from note to note undermines good technique.
So. once more, if you want to get at the problem you've asked about, you need first to figure out what the problem is. You keep asking for a practice approach, and several suggestions were made early in the thread that could be effective *if your technique is the source of the problem.* If it isn't, then you need to find the source and fix that (or have it fixed by someone who knows what to do about it). Applying a technical solution to a mechanical problem can simply lead to bad habits, which presumably is not your goal.
You really need more experienced ears to help you with this. As in so many other areas, the effectiveness of answers from cyberspace is badly limited by the fact that no one here can hear you or analyze your playing. Your inexperience as a player limits your ability to describe the situation clearly. That isn't your fault. It comes with the territory. But an experienced teacher listening to you in person could help so much more effectively because he or she wouldn't need to rely on your perception but could hear and see your playing for him(her)self.
